Physical Benefits of Massage After an Accident
Massage therapy can be incredibly beneficial for those who have been involved in a car crash. Research has found that massage therapy can help reduce inflammation, improve circulation, and even speed up the healing process. It can also reduce tension in the muscles caused by sudden trauma from the impact of an accident. This means that massage therapy can reduce pain and discomfort, as well as prevent chronic pain from developing later on down the line.

Massage Therapy for Physical Pain Relief and Injury Recovery
Massage therapy can be used to reduce physical pain from the car accident, as well as speed up recovery from any injuries suffered during the crash. Massage therapists are trained to work with people who have acute or chronic musculoskeletal injuries. Many massage therapists specialize in specific types of treatment that target areas affected by automobile accidents such as whiplash, neck strain, and lower back pain. Massages help reduce swelling, reduce muscle spasms, improve range of motion, and increase flexibility while also relieving stress and promoting relaxation.

Massage Therapy for Mental Health Benefits
Massage therapy can also provide mental health benefits after experiencing a car accident. It helps reduce anxiety, depression, sleeplessness, PTSD symptoms (such as flashbacks), hypervigilance (always being on guard), irritability, fatigue and other mental health issues related to traumatic events like car accidents. A massage therapist will use techniques such as Swedish massage (long strokes using light pressure) or deep tissue massage (deep pressure applied to specific areas) to calm the mind and body while relieving tension in tense muscles.
Choosing the Right Massage Therapist
If you decide that getting a massage is the right choice for you after your car accident it’s important to choose the right massage therapist for your needs. It’s best to find someone who has experience working with people recovering from motor vehicle accidents since they’ll have specialized knowledge about treating these types of injuries. Ask your friends or family if they know of any qualified practitioners or check online reviews before scheduling your appointment with a new therapist.
